I Don't clean Coils much anymore. I just plug a New Coil in.

But when I do, I have one of these where I cut about about 2/3 of the Bristles Off.

s-l1600.jpg


These Stainless Steel Brushes are made to go into a Rotary / Dremel Tool. And you can find the Cheap on e-Bay or Amazon.

I do a Quick n' Dirty Dry Burn. Then a Rinse while giving the Coil a Light Brushing. I find they work Better than a Firm Toothbrush.

I pulse my ss tricore fc coils with 14w, to a dull red, repeat until the black is gone then rinse with water then pulse a couple times to dry. I diy and don't use much sweetener so usually 2-3 pulses is enough. If you are using sweet juices or custards you might want to pulse a couple times then rinse; repeat until black is gone. If you are using single wire builds I'd personally just wrap another coil like Zoid does.
